Abstract

The combined use of the time moment and Padé approximation methods (in time space and frequency domain description), coupled with three powerful dominant pole selection criteria, is introduced for the purpose of application to high-order MIMO linear time-invariant state-space original system models, in order to obtain corresponding adequate reduced order model(s). The proposed approach has been applied successfully to a 10th-order two-input two-output time-invariant linear model of a practical power system.
